New Member – Okamoto & Company

May 27, 2006

Okamoto & Company has specialised in providing bilingual professional accounting services to foreign subsidiaries since 1992. They are a three – partner firm and employ 25 professionals and approximately the same number of support staff. Partner, Richard Okamoto gives an insight into his firm and how he is looking forward to working within Kreston.

Many of the professionals within Okamoto & Co are US CPAs or Japanese licensed tax accountants who have spent time in the US and other foreign countries. A majority of our clients are publicly listed in their respective home countries and many are in the IT industry. The primary source of our engagements has been from referrals from the Big Four firms.

We value maintaining strong relationships with our clients and periodically conduct client satisfaction surveys. Some of our main lines of businesses are as follows:

Accounting Outsourcing – We provide monthly bookkeeping or periodical reviews of the accounts at the client’s premises. Financial statements can be compiled under Japanese GAAP, U.S. GAAP or IFRS.

Payroll Outsourcing – The processing and monthly payroll, social insurance registrations procedures are the major functions within payroll outsourcing. Our licensed Social Insurance and Labour specialists can advise on local labour law compliance matters.

Cash Management – We would maintain a bank account under our client ‘s name and on a monthly basis, prepare funding requests, process operating expenses, payroll, and tax payments on their behalf.

Auditing – Our experienced CPAs, CIAs, CISAs would work with their overseas counterparts in conducting financial audits, internal audits, royalty audits and/or business reviews. We are one of a handful of firms registered with the PCAOB in the U.S.

SOX – Our professionals have performed dozens of SOX 404 engagements, especially as it relates to documentation and testing, for a wide range of industries.

Taxes – With our association with Hanato Tax Accountant Office, we are able to prepare a wide variety of corporate and consumption tax returns and advise on local tax issues.
